Passive voice speaking cards Set 5 (Past progressive) - editable
Speaking cards to practise the passive voice. Set 5: Past progressive. Print page 2 on the back of page 1, laminate and cut the cards. Students get the cards and must ask each other to transform the sentence from active to passive or vice versa. The solutions are on the back. (You can turn it into a game: You win a card if you give a correct answer...

An ideal hotel
Holiday-themed activity to practice speaking skills.
Based on their likes and dislikes given in the cards, students have first to decide for themselves what hotel out of four is ideal for them and then to persuade their partner that is an ideal place to spend their holiday together.

Present perfect continuous - The accusation game
This game illustrates the use of the present perfect continuous for present result. Students work in small groups to guess what they are being accused of. Detailed instructions on page 2. Students may feel a bit uneasy at first since they have to "accuse" another student, but once they get going it�s really good fun! My students enjoyed it a lot.
